> Hi Syd,
>
> The support for NVDL is implemented in Jing (the latest release is
> 20091111), with the exception of support for embedded schemas.
> As Radu mentioned, the NVDL implementation from oNVDL was
> moved back to
> Jing.

> >> oNVDL was transformed into the jing-trang project:
> >> http://code.google.com/p/jing-trang/ The latest
> distribution is from
> >> 11-11-2009. But to my knowledge support for ISO Schematron was not
> >> yet added.
